Output fc88db61d0fb73b36149f494a062a1df74930918a113dda64634230159f449c4:33

value
502213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c51afe8bf6a552efbc508c6a9565df6d97411ba OP_EQUAL
address
37BxKmxUokhqsdLc9spQky4Q69eMjochg5
transaction
fc88db61d0fb73b36149f494a062a1df74930918a113dda64634230159f449c4
confirmations
185542
spent
true